引言
Windows操作系统中的本地组策略编辑器(Local Group Policy Editor)是系统管理员进行系统配置和管理的重要工具。通过使用命令提示符(CMD)进行操作,可以更加高效地修改本地组策略,无需打开图形界面。本文将详细介绍如何在CMD中修改本地组策略,帮助系统管理员提升工作效率。
1. 了解本地组策略
本地组策略编辑器允许管理员对计算机上的用户和组进行配置。这些策略可以控制从用户登录到应用程序使用的各个方面,包括安全设置、网络配置、应用程序安装等。
2. 打开CMD
要使用CMD修改本地组策略,首先需要打开命令提示符。可以通过以下几种方式打开CMD:
- 按下Win + R键,输入“cmd”并按Enter键。
- 在开始菜单中搜索“命令提示符”并打开。
- 右键点击“此电脑”或“我的电脑”,选择“管理”,在弹出的窗口中找到“命令提示符”并打开。
3. 修改本地组策略
在CMD中,可以使用gpedit.msc
命令打开本地组策略编辑器,但为了更高效地修改策略,我们可以使用以下命令:
3.1 查看策略
使用以下命令查看特定策略的状态:
gpresult /r /h C:\path\to\output.html
这个命令将生成一个HTML文件,其中包含所有策略的当前状态。将C:\path\to\output.html
替换为你希望保存HTML文件的位置。
3.2 修改策略
要修改策略,可以使用以下命令:
gpedit.msc /v <策略名称> /t <目标值>
其中,<策略名称>
是你要修改的策略名称,<目标值>
是新值。以下是一些常见的策略名称和目标值:
User Account Control: Run all administrators in Admin Approval Mode
:Enabled
或Disabled
Network Security: Do not store LAN Manager hash value on next password change
:Enabled
或Disabled
Windows Update: Configure Automatic Updates
:Enabled
、Disabled
或Notify Before Download
3.3 应用策略
修改策略后,需要使用以下命令使更改生效:
gpupdate /force
这个命令将强制更新策略,并立即应用更改。
4. 高级技巧
4.1 使用批处理脚本
为了自动化修改策略的过程,可以使用批处理脚本。以下是一个简单的批处理脚本示例,用于启用或禁用特定策略:
@echo off
set /p "policy=Enter the policy name: "
set /p "value=Enter the new value (Enabled/Disabled): "
gpedit.msc /v "%policy%" /t "%value%"
gpupdate /force
将此脚本保存为.bat
文件,并在需要时运行它。
4.2 使用注册表编辑器
虽然直接修改注册表不建议,但在某些情况下,可以使用注册表编辑器(regedit.exe)来修改本地组策略。打开注册表编辑器,导航到以下路径: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on
在此路径下,你可以找到与组策略相关的键,如SpecialAccounts\UserList
和SpecialAccounts\InteractiveLogon
。
结论
通过使用CMD修改本地组策略,系统管理员可以更加高效地管理和配置Windows系统。掌握这些技巧可以帮助你节省时间,提高工作效率。记住,在修改策略之前,请确保备份重要数据,并在修改过程中谨慎操作。